Background
In order to improve the efficiency of nucleic acid detection, the nucleic acid detection is required to be carried out outdoors many times, the outdoor detection is mostly a nucleic acid detection pavilion which is temporarily built, and medical personnel carry out sampling service on social individuals and collective units at a sampling point. Most of detection areas for standing detection of the existing nucleic acid detection pavilion for the personnel to be detected are in an open-air state, when the nucleic acid detection pavilion is used for detection of key groups, large potential safety hazards exist, cross infection risks exist, and meanwhile when the detection environment is in a rain and snow weather condition, the top of the pavilion is free of shielding objects when the personnel to be detected detect, and clothes are easy to wet and cause catching a cold and getting ill.

A novel nucleic acid detection kiosk, comprising: the detection device comprises a pavilion body (1) and a detection area arranged outside the pavilion body (1), wherein the detection window (3) is formed in one side, located in the detection area, of the pavilion body (1), the detection area is formed by enclosing an upper supporting plate (6), a lower supporting plate (7), an openable door body (11) and a connecting plate (18), the upper supporting plate (6) is connected to the top end of the pavilion body (1), the lower supporting plate (7) is connected to the bottom end of the pavilion body (1), semicircular first sliding rails (8) are respectively connected to the left end and the right end of the inner side of the upper supporting plate (6), semicircular second sliding rails (17) are respectively connected to the left end and the right end of the inner side of the lower supporting plate (7), the openable door body (11) is installed between the first sliding rails (8) and the second sliding rails (17) corresponding to the ends in a sliding mode, the connecting plate (18) located between the openable door bodies (11) at the two ends is further arranged between the upper supporting plate (6) and the lower supporting plate (7), and a disinfection spraying device is further installed on the surface of the inner side of the upper supporting plate (6);
after the openable door bodies (11) at the two ends are opened, an inlet and an outlet are formed at the two ends of the detection area respectively; after the openable door bodies (11) at the two ends are closed, the disinfection spraying device is started to realize the disinfection operation of the detection area.
2. The novel nucleic acid detection kiosk according to claim 1, characterized in that: and a detection frame (2) connected to the outer wall of the pavilion body (1) is arranged below the detection window (3), and the detection frame (2) is positioned in the detection area.
3. The novel nucleic acid detection kiosk according to claim 1, characterized in that: an arc-shaped sliding groove (13) is formed in the upper surface of the upper supporting plate (6), the arc-shaped sliding groove (13) and the first sliding rail (8) on the corresponding side are arranged in parallel, and the top of one side, away from the connecting plate (18), of the openable door body (11) is connected with a rolling ball (16) which is arranged in the arc-shaped sliding groove (13) in a rolling mode through a connecting frame (15).
4. The novel nucleic acid detection kiosk according to claim 3, characterized in that: the outer wall of the openable door body (11) is fixedly connected with a mounting ring (14), and the center of the mounting ring (14) is connected with the connecting frame (15).
5. The novel nucleic acid detection kiosk according to claim 1, characterized in that: the pavilion is characterized in that a fixed frame (4) is connected to the outer surface of one side, provided with the detection window (3), of the pavilion body (1), and the top end and the bottom end of the fixed frame (4) are respectively connected with an upper supporting plate (6) and a lower supporting plate (7) through installation clamping seats (5).
6. The novel nucleic acid detection kiosk according to claim 1, characterized in that: an upper sliding seat (9) is connected to the first sliding rail (8) in a sliding mode, and the upper sliding seat (9) is connected to the top end of the openable door body (11).
7. The novel nucleic acid detection kiosk according to claim 1, characterized in that: and a lower sliding seat (10) is connected in the second sliding rail (17) in a sliding manner, and the top end of the lower sliding seat (10) is connected to the bottom end of the openable door body (11).
